ST-7104
Advanced HD decoder for iDTV
Data brief
Features
■ Advanced high definition video decoding
(H264/VC-1/MPEG2)
■ Advanced standard definition video decoding
(H264/VC-1/MPEG2/AVS)
■ Advanced multi-channel audio decoding
(MPEG 1, 2, MP 3, DD/DD+, AAC/AAC+, and
WMA9/WMA9pro)
■ Linux, Windows CE, and OS21 compatible
ST40 applications CPU (450 MHz)
■ 32-bit DDR1/DDR2 compatible local memory
interface
■ Multi-stream, DVR capable transport stream
processing
JTAG
ST40-300 core 450 MHz
TMUs/INTC
UDI
32 K I cache
CPU/FPU core
MMU
32 K D cache
DDR2
SDRAM
16/32
LMI
6-channel
PCM out
2-ch
PCM in
Audio decoder
Audio L/R
out
Audio
DACs
players and
interfaces
ST231
core
S/PDIF
out
■ Extensive connectivity (dual USB hosts,
e-SATA, Ethernet MAC/MII/RMII, and PCI)
■ Separate digital video and graphics outputs
Description
The ST-7104 uses state of the art process
technology to provide a cost effective, fully
featured HD AVC decoder IC. It is a highly
integrated system-on-chip suitable for low-cost
add-on module for iDTV manufacturers.
The ST-7104 is targeted at the latest CE
manufacturer requirements for iDTVs which utilize
advanced HD decoding (H264/VC-1/MPEG2),
and which conform to DVB, SCTE, ATSC, ARIB,
CEA, ITU and OpenCable specifications.
Serial ATA
HDD, int/ext
eSAT A
interface
Dual
USB 2.0
hosts
USB
2.0
USB
2.0
Key
Scan
2x I/F
SmCard
GPIOs
Peripheral I/O
and external interrupts
Comms
IR Tx/Rx
UHF Rx
ILC
4x
UARTs
Serial
FLASH
SPI
4x
SSC/I2C
PWM
STBus
Capture
Ethernet,
MAC
MII/RMII
Delta Mu
advanced
video decoder
ST231
Output
stage
TXT
Sec
Dual
PTI
3
SWTS
2
TSmerger/router
TS TS TS
IN2IN0 IN1/OUT0
TS
IN3
PDES
2
Clock gen
and
system
services
Resets/
clocks/
modes
DUAL
FDMA
Bdisp
blitter
DENC
Main/aux display
compositor and
pass through
6DACs
Analog video
output
(HD/SD)
Main video
display
VTGs
DEI
Aux video
display
DVO0 DVO1
Digital
Digital
video
output 1
output 0
PCI
video
June 2009 Doc ID 15860 Rev 1 1/7
For further information contact your local STMicroelectronics sales office.
EMI
FLASH
NOR/NAND
SFLASH
www.st.com
7
Description ST-7104
1 Description
The ST-7104 offers current users of ST’s growing family of advanced decoding ICs
enhancements in performance and features, whilst reducing cost and time-to-market for the
next generation deployments.
2/7 Doc ID 15860 Rev 1
ST-7104 Main features
2 Main features
The ST-7104 has the following features:
● Integrates in a single IC, Multi-stream transport demux, CPU, A/V decode, Video
processing, Graphics and Display, peripherals, Audio/Video DACs, Digital A/V outputs,
e-SATA port, dual USB ports and Ethernet MAC/MII
● High performance CPUs for applications (ST40) and audio/video decoding (2 x ST231)
– ST40-300, dual-issue, appl ic at ion s CPU, 32K I, 32KD cach es :
Target speed > 450 MHz delivering > 800 DMIPs
● Single 32-bit DDR1/DDR2 Local Memory Interface (LMI), up to 400 MHz
● Latest generation “Delta” Video Decoder with ST231 programmable CPU core:
– MPEG2, H264, VC-1/WM9, HD or SD Advanced Video Decoding
– AVS SD decoding
– Provides flexibility to support other codecs (DivX, XviD, H263 encode/decode)
– HD and SD decoding or dual SD Decoding, PIP & Mosaic capable
– Real-time transcoding of MPEG2 SD to H264 SIF
● Advanced de-blocking of decoded MPEG2 SD sources based on ST’s DSE (Digital
Source Enhancer) Technology with 2D Analysis window and Texture Adaptive Filter
● ST231 CPU based Audio Decoder. MPEG1 I/II, MP3, Dolby Digital/DD+, MPEG4
AAC/AAC+ multi-channel audio decoding. Concurrent audio description decoding.
DD+ and AAC+ transcodi ng
● Main and Aux Video display pipelines:
– Main: high quality H & V reformatting/resizing with sample rate
conversion/filtering. Motion adaptive spatial and temporal de-interlacing for
480p/576p and 1080p60 progressive output
– Aux: high quality H & V reformatting/resizing with sample rate conversion/filtering
● Three independent graphics planes with H&V resize, CLUT and anti-flicker filtering
● Link list based 2D graphics blitter. Up to 200 Mpixels/sec with destination alpha
blending. Capable of 3D user interface effects.
● Independent Main and Aux display compositions (Video/Graphics mixing)
● Pass-through display for graphics, main video or aux video output concurrently with
main and aux compositions
● HD display capture and down-conversion for concurrent HD and SD output of the main
composition
● 16-bit Digital Video Output for main display composition (HD/ED/SD formats up to
1080p60)
● Second 32-bit (ARGB) Digital Video Output for pass through display or main/aux
display compositions (HD/ED/SD formats up to 1080p60)
● Macrovision copy protection support
● PAL/NTSC/SECAM Digital encoder
● Six 10-bit DACs for component/composite analog video output (HD/ED/SD formats up
to 1080i)
● Integrated Stereo Audio DAC
● Six-channel Audio PCM Output Interface
Doc ID 15860 Rev 1 3/7